SFMS presents Pride of New York

The Pride of New York is an Irish-American super group comprised of some of the best known players on this side of the Atlantic. Between them, they have won four All-Ireland championship awards, recorded multiple solo albums, and logged countless miles touring across the US and abroad. But, at its essence, this quartet of singular talents is defined in spirit by the city of New York which gives the group its name.

Four quintessential New York musicians:

  • Brian Conway — one of the best fiddlers of his generation, playing in the Sligo style
  • Billy McComiskey — the finest button accordion player ever to emerge from the United States
  • Joanie Madden — leader of Cherish the Ladies, and the first American to win the Senior All-Ireland championship on the tin whistle
  • Brendan Dolan — stellar multi-instrumentalist who’s worked with some of the brightest stars on the Irish-American scene
